What is Creatine and How Does It Benefit Your Performance?

Creatine is a naturally occurring compound found primarily in muscle cells. It plays a crucial role in the energy production system, particularly the phosphocreatine system, which is responsible for providing quick bursts of energy during high-intensity activities. In simple terms, when you perform activities like sprinting, heavy lifting, or jumping, your body uses ATP (adenosine triphosphate) for energy. Creatine helps replenish ATP stores rapidly, allowing you to sustain high-intensity efforts for longer periods.
What Are the Key Benefits of Creatine Supplementation?
Creatine supplementation has been extensively studied and shown to offer a range of performance-enhancing benefits. These benefits can be broadly categorized into short-term and long-term effects:
Improved Exercise Performance:
Creatine enhances the body's ability to regenerate ATP, leading to increased power output and improved performance in high-intensity exercises. It allows for more repetitions and sets during weightlifting, leading to greater training volume. It improves sprint performance, particularly in repeated sprint activities.
Increased Muscle Mass:
Creatine promotes water retention within muscle cells, leading to cellular swelling, which can stimulate muscle protein synthesis. It enhances the body's ability to recover from intense workouts, reducing muscle damage and promoting muscle growth.
Better Strength Output:
By replenishing ATP stores, creatine allows for greater force production during resistance training. This translates to increased strength gains over time.
Faster Recovery:
Creatine can reduce muscle damage and inflammation following intense exercise, leading to faster recovery times. It can help replenish glycogen stores after strenuous exercise.
Potential Cognitive Benefits:
Some studies suggest that creatine may have cognitive benefits, particularly in tasks requiring short-term memory and processing speed. This is especially true in vegetarians and vegans, who often have lower baseline creatine levels.
Bone Health:
Emerging research is investigating the potential benefits of creatine for bone health, particularly in older adults.
What Happens to Your Body Before You Start Taking Creatine?
Before you begin creatine supplementation, your body relies on its natural creatine stores, which are obtained through diet (primarily meat and fish) and synthesized by the liver, kidneys, and pancreas. However, these natural stores are typically not saturated, meaning there's room for improvement.
Your energy levels and workout performance before using creatine are generally limited by the availability of ATP. You might find that you fatigue quickly during high-intensity exercises, struggle to maintain power output, and experience longer recovery times. Creatine helps fill up your muscles with phosphocreatine, which acts as a readily available energy reserve. This allows you to push harder during workouts, leading to greater strength gains and muscle growth.
The First Few Days of Creatine: What to Expect?
The initial phase of creatine supplementation, often referred to as the "creatine loading phase," involves taking a higher dose of creatine (typically 20 grams per day, divided into four doses) for 5-7 days. This phase is designed to rapidly saturate muscle creatine stores.
During the first few days, you might experience a slight increase in body weight due to water retention within muscle cells. This is a normal and temporary effect. Some individuals may also experience mild gastrointestinal discomfort, such as bloating or stomach cramps, although this is less common.
You may also experience a quick boost in energy, and notice you can lift heavier weights, or do more reps than normal.
How Does Creatine Change Your Body Over the First 30 Days?
Over the first 30 days of creatine supplementation, you should start to notice significant improvements in your workout performance. You'll likely experience increased strength, power, and muscle endurance. This allows for greater training volume, which can lead to noticeable muscle growth.
The water retention effect will stabilize, and your body weight may remain slightly elevated. You should also experience faster recovery times between workouts, allowing you to train more frequently and effectively.
Creatine will help increase the muscles ability to recover after exertion, and will help the muscles produce more power during exertion.
Can Creatine Cause Weight Gain?
Yes, creatine can cause weight gain, primarily due to water retention within muscle cells. This is not fat gain, but rather an increase in intracellular water. The amount of weight gain varies from person to person, but it's typically in the range of 1-3 kilograms (2-6 pounds) in the initial weeks of supplementation.
It's important to differentiate between water weight and fat gain. Creatine does not directly cause fat gain. In fact, by improving workout performance it can indirectly contribute to fat loss by allowing you to burn more calories during exercise.
Can Creatine Have Side Effects After Prolonged Use?
Creatine is generally considered safe for long-term use, and numerous studies have confirmed its safety profile. However, some potential side effects have been reported, although they are relatively rare and mild:
-
Gastrointestinal Issues:
Some individuals may experience bloating, stomach cramps, or diarrhea, particularly during the loading phase.
-
Muscle Cramps:
While creatine can improve muscle function, some people report experiencing muscle cramps, possibly due to dehydration.
-
Dehydration:
Because Creatine draws water into the muscle cells, it is very important to stay hydrated.
-
Kidney Concerns:
While studies have shown creatine to be safe for healthy individuals, those with pre-existing kidney conditions should consult with their doctor before taking creatine. There is no evidence in healthy individuals that creatine causes kidney damage.
-
Interactions with Medications:
Creatine may interact with certain medications, such as diuretics. It's important to consult with your doctor if you're taking any medications. It is very important to stay hydrated when taking creatine.

Frequently Asked Questions:
What is the best time to take creatine for maximum effect?
The timing of creatine intake is less critical than consistent daily supplementation. Some studies suggest that taking creatine after a workout, along with carbohydrates and protein, may enhance absorption. However, taking it at any time of day is generally effective.
Can I take creatine on rest days?
Yes, it's recommended to take creatine on rest days to maintain saturated muscle creatine stores. Consistency is key to maximizing its benefits.
Can creatine cause bloating or stomach discomfort?
Yes, some individuals may experience bloating or stomach discomfort, particularly during the loading phase. Dividing the daily dose into smaller portions and taking it with food can help minimize these effects.
How much water should I drink while taking creatine?
It's important to stay well-hydrated while taking creatine. Aim to drink plenty of water throughout the day, especially during and after workouts.
Is creatine safe to take long-term?
Yes, creatine is generally considered safe for long-term use in healthy individuals. However, it's always advisable to consult with your doctor, especially if you have any pre-existing health conditions.
